AI-driven software for radiology workflows
Rad AI enhances radiology workflows using artificial intelligence to improve efficiency and accuracy in radiological practices. Its main product, Omni Reporting, automates routine tasks, ensures follow-up on incidental findings, and improves reporting accuracy. This software integrates seamlessly into existing workflows, making it easier for radiologists to manage their tasks. Unlike competitors, Rad AI emphasizes data security and patient privacy, being SOC 2 Type II and HIPAA certified. The company's goal is to provide reliable AI-driven solutions that streamline healthcare processes and improve patient outcomes.
